About Caterpillar Company

Caterpillar, Inc. engages in the business of manufacturing construction and mining equipment, off-highway diesel and natural gas engines, industrial gas turbines, and diesel-electric locomotives. It operates through the following segments: Construction Industries, Resource Industries, Energy and Transportation, Financial Products, and All Other. The Construction Industries segment is involved in supporting customers using machinery in infrastructure and building construction applications. The Resource Industries segment offers machinery in mining, heavy construction, quarry, and aggregates. The Energy and Transportation segment focuses on reciprocating engines, turbines, diesel-electric locomotives, and related services across industries serving oil and gas, power generation, industrial, and transportation applications including marine- and rail-related businesses. The Financial Products segment provides financing alternatives to customers and dealers for Caterpillar products and services, as well as financing for power generation facilities. The All Other segment includes activities such as the business strategy, product management and development, manufacturing, and sourcing of wear and maintenance components products, parts distribution, integrated logistics solutions, distribution services responsible for dealer development, and administration. The company was founded on April 15, 1925 and is headquartered in Irving, TX.
